Evan Ramsay


Evan is the Sr. Director of the Renewables Program and has been with BEF since 2014 and leads the organization’s work on renewable energy, demand response, energy efficiency, and electrification.  He brings deep renewable energy experience and has consulted with hundreds of communities, businesses, governments, and utilities to provide technical, financial, development, and management expertise on projects across the country.


His work at BEF includes pioneering the region’s first low-income benefitting community solar project, supporting dozens of low-impact hydro projects, engaging on multiple levels of energy policy, supporting the founding of the Renewable Hydrogen Alliance, commissioning cost/benefit studies on vehicle electrification, delivering the first hydrogen fueling station in the Pacific Northwest, and leveraging over $30m in funding to support such projects.
